Exit the … WebNov 18, 2016 · Layers. A layer is a set of collections of objects (and their drawing options) required for specific tasks. You can have multiple layers in the scene for compositing effects, or simply to control the visibility and drawing settings of objects in different ways (aiming at different tasks). A layer also has its own set of active and selected ...
